Canadian Astronaut Chris Hadfield has had a moustache since age 18

A video supporting Movember campaign astronaut Chris Hadfield, prostate cancer awareness and encourage men to grow moustaches for donations is held every year in November.




For whatever reason, I decided: ‘I’m 18, I’m a man, I’m going to grow a moustache’ — and it was pathetic for years — it was awful,” he told the Canadian Press newswire this week.

Now 54, the Canadian scientist would have had no idea just how famous that moustache would become when he first decided to grow it while waiting for a train in Turkey. Following his stint as commander of the International Space Station, he even lent his influence and facial hair to the Movember campaign in a video that basically just entailed Hadfield saying “I have a moustache.” And yes, yes he does.

According to the CP report, Hadfield only shaved his moustache one time since becoming a legal adult, when training to become a test pilot.

“In the U.S. air force, if you want to get promoted you can’t have a moustache, for whatever reason,” he said. ”It just looks bad when they’re flipping through the pictures. Don’t ask me why.

“So, as I was at test pilot school, one of the guys was having his annual photograph taken (and) he had to shave off his moustache, so…in solidarity I shaved it off.”

His bald upper lip didn’t last long, however. According to Hadfield, “nobody was impressed” with how he looked without the moustache, least of all his wife Helene, so he quickly grew it back and has kept it ever since.
